Notes
--> Royal Challengers Bangalore powerplay 1: overs 1 to 6 (52/1)
--> Chennai Super Kings powerplay 1: overs 1 to 6 (55/2)
--> Royal Challengers Bangalore innings: 50 in 5.5 overs
--> Royal Challengers Bangalore innings: 100 in 10.4 overs
--> Royal Challengers Bangalore innings: 150 in 15.3 overs
--> Royal Challengers Bangalore innings: 200 in 19.5 overs
--> Chennai Super Kings innings: 50 in 4.6 overs
--> Chennai Super Kings innings: 100 in 11.5 overs
--> Chennai Super Kings innings: 150 in 15.6 overs
--> Chennai Super Kings innings: 200 in 19.2 overs
--> CJ Anderson made his last appearance in Indian Premier League matches
--> Q de Kock 50 in 35 balls with 1 four and 4 sixes
--> AB de Villiers 50 in 23 balls with 2 fours and 6 sixes
--> AT Rayudu 50 in 40 balls with 2 fours and 5 sixes
--> AT Rayudu passed his previous highest score of 81 in Indian Premier League matches
--> AT Rayudu passed his previous highest score of 81 in Twenty20 matches
--> SK Raina passed 7500 runs in Twenty20 matches when he reached 4
--> MS Dhoni 50 in 29 balls with 1 four and 5 sixes
--> C de Grandhomme made his debut for Royal Challengers Bangalore in Indian Premier League matches
--> C de Grandhomme made his debut for Royal Challengers Bangalore in Twenty20 matches
--> UT Yadav reached 100 wickets in Indian Premier League matches when he dismissed SK Raina, his 1st wicket in the Chennai Super Kings innings
--> Q de Kock (23) and AB de Villiers (27) added 50 in 32 balls for the Royal Challengers Bangalore 2nd wicket
--> Q de Kock (35) and AB de Villiers (65) added 100 in 49 balls for the Royal Challengers Bangalore 2nd wicket
--> AT Rayudu (12) and MS Dhoni (36) added 50 in 30 balls for the Chennai Super Kings 5th wicket
--> AT Rayudu (39) and MS Dhoni (55) added 100 in 53 balls for the Chennai Super Kings 5th wicket
